To access your Asus router, you will need to login into your asus router. In this article, we will provide you step by step instructions on how to access your asus router. By login into your asus router, you can manage or modify all the settings on your asus router such as change admin or recover admin password, WiFi password change, change Asus router username, allow or disallow particular wired or wireless device, recover forget password, create new guest network account or setup and create parental control feature etc. Please go through the below steps one by one to access the asus router and do not forget to read the notes and tips section below.

Notes -  

Connect your computer to the router via LAN cable and do not use wireless devices to access the asus router.

Admin password is not the WiFi password of your Asus router. It can be used only for the Asus router login page.

You will find all the default login credentials on the back panel of your Asus router.

Basic steps to access the asus router 

Connect your device to the Asus router by connecting ethernet cable on both ends.
Check if you are connected to the internet or not. Your device should be connected only on Asus router home WiFi network.
Now launch any new browser such as Google chrome, Mozilla firefox, Internet Explorer, opera or any other available web browser. We prefer you to use google chrome browser.
On the top of the new page, please type router.asus.com ot http://router.asus.com.
Note - If router.asus.com not redirecting you to the asus login page, then type the IP address into the web address bar. You can find the IP address of your Asus router on the back panel of the router.
On the Asus login window, enter username and password.
Username and admin password is admin/admin. Both in lowercase.
Note:- Do not use WiFi name or WiFi password in this required field. Username and admin password can be used only to access the router and not for connecting your device. 
Click on login to continue.

Now you can modify or change the settings of Asus router.
